Using libertarian kids' books to teach children about freedom, responsibility, and self-reliance helps them develop critical thinking skills. These books introduce ideas like personal choice, limited government, and the importance of voluntary cooperation. By learning about these values early, kids can better understand independence, respect for others, and the impact of their decisions on society.
